Sunset at the end of the world. The end has come.... I wish I had something really awe insipring to tell, but the journey has been more than I can sum up in words. I arrived here in Santiago on June 2nd, with my good friend from the camino, Pablo. Hi Pablo! It was incredible, we walked up to the catherdral and I felt so happy to have made it. What a journey, I cannot really describe how it was, but all of you who have been on it know. The hard parts, and the days I thought I might not make it have already started to fade away and all that´s left is the joy and freinds and things I learned. Yesterday I spent part of the day in Santiago de Compostela, and then drove out to Finisterre with Pablo, his dad Manolo, and another lady from Norway Gulru. That was great too! We sat at the end of the world and just thought back on the whole experience. Then we burned some clothes! Its a pilgrim tradtion to get there and burn your socks or something. Today Im off to Madrid to meet my mom and travel around Spain until I go to Ireland to
visit some more friends from the Camino! I am offically coming back on June 25th, and I cant wait to see everyone in California!
